Tri-Valley High School is a High in Downs, IL. It currently serves 313 students (grades 09-12). The school is part of the Tri Valley CUSD 3 School District.

Other Details
School Type: Regular School
School Level: High
Number of Students:313
Number of Teachers: 25
Student/Teacher Ratio: 12.75
